Different types of portable toilets are available, varying in size and amenities. Let’s explore some different kinds of portable toilets.
Standard porta potties – These are the most common moveable bathrooms. They mostly come as a single unit arranged in clusters for outdoor events. They are the simplest form of portable toilet. They don’t have a flushing system. They feature a simple yet secure locking mechanism. They are most suitable for short events since they have a small tank capacity of around 50-70 gallons. Standard porta potties usually come in sizes of 43-46 by 46-48 by 88-91 inches. They are mostly used in construction sites and industrial areas.
Deluxe porta potties – These portable restrooms, in simplest words, are a standard moveable restroom with a sink. They are upgraded versions of the standard porta potties, designed for added comfort. They include a sink and a tank with a 60-70 gallon capacity.
In addition to being flushable, these porta potties include a hand washing station, mirror, and side urinal. Certain units even feature a baby changing station. These are suitable for events that need high sanitation and hand washing like food tasting events and those with kids.
Construction porta potties – As indicated by the name, these are standard portable toilets used in construction or industrial settings. They come with steel side rails where a crane can lift them from one floor of a construction site to another. They are ideal for multi-floor construction sites.
Trail mounted porta potties – Standard portable restrooms mounted on a trailer. They are built with brake lights and tires to facilitate safe towing. These can be safely parked and used anywhere. These units are suitable for mobile worksites like highway road work, field-based media, and disaster relief.
Portable restrooms – These units are also referred to as luxury or VIP restrooms. They are designed like large trailers. These units come with flushing toilets, running water, counter space, and modern interior like lighting. These trailers can accommodate up to ten bathrooms.
Handicap-accessible porta potties – These portable toilets are designed for wheelchair users and individuals with disabilities. These units are wider and more spacious compared to standard portable toilets. They feature a flat entrance or ramp to ease access for wheelchair users. These porta potties are equipped with safety handrails, lower toilet seats, and anti-slip carpeting for safety. These units comply with ADA regulations.
Green porta potties – Designed for those who prioritize environmental sustainability. These units are made from recycled materials, promoting environmental friendliness. They are designed with health-conscious features and environmentally friendly procedures. Their features are comparable to the other types mentioned.
What kinds of events need a porta potty?
Concerts – Concerts bring together a lot of people, mainly in large grounds. Even with permanent bathrooms, you will not be able to cater for a concert. You need to hire a couple of porta potties for the one- or two-day concert to facilitate the success of a concert.
Events – Adequate portable restrooms are crucial for guest comfort at any event. The type of event determines the kind of portable restroom you should rent. A wedding calls for a luxury porta potty rather than a standard unit. It’s essential to provide the best facilities for your guests.
Festivals – A festival also sees a lot of people from different walks of life attend. You need to provide some traveling potties to ensure the attendees have somewhere to go after a couple of meals or drinks.
Family reunions – Planning a Thanksgiving gathering with extended family?. The indoor permanent toilet may not be enough to cater for a large number of people. Hire a portable toilet that is flushable and includes a handwashing station, as meals will be served. Additionally, you can rent units with baby changing stations or those accessible for the physically handicapped. It’s important to cater to everyone’s needs when renting portable restrooms.
Construction sites – Portable restrooms are vital for any commercial or residential construction site. They can be moved between floors, minimizing the distance workers need to travel. These units make the construction site more hygienic and increase the general productivity of the workers.
Parties – Any party, whether a birthday party, wedding, anniversary, office party, etc. requires a moveable potty. The guests will need a place to relieve themselves or wash their hands, and your indoor toilet may not be suitable for a large group of people.
